drm/i915/hdmi: Split intel_hdmi_bpc_possible() to source vs. sink pair



intel_hdmi_bpc_possible() is used by the DP code as well where
the native HDMI source limits do not apply. So let's split this
into a pair of functions: one for the source vs. one for the sink.

This is basically reverting some of commit 41828125 ("drm/i915:
Move platform checks into intel_hdmi_bpc_possible()") slightly,
but in a nicer form. I guess I forgot at the time that the DP side
uses this too.
